Start with the building envelope, no longer the color swatch
Siding, home windows, and doors take a seat on the dermis of the home, yet they're simply one layer of efficiency. The weather-resistive barrier, tapes, flashing, insulation, and air sealing together shape how your home handles water, air, and heat. A high-stop window can underperform if the tough opening leaks air on the shims. A heavy steel door can flex if the jamb isn't always rectangular after a subfloor has swelled. I like initially a brief exterior audit: determine the eaves, soffits, gutters, and the grade around the root. If the downspouts at a home close Courtice Road are dumping water appropriate onto a walkway that slopes in the direction of the space, one could chase leaks around a new sill unless you fabulous the drainage.
I additionally seek hollow-sounding sheathing, wavy partitions, or mushy spots at the base of corners. That determines even if we want sheathing upkeep ahead of new siding or whether it really is protected to overlay. On a bungalow north of Nash Road, we stumbled on 3 bays wherein the common fiberboard had softened in the back of aluminum. Without exchanging these panels and rewrapping the wall, any new siding would have flexed and cracked inside of a yr.
Siding options that make sense in Courtice
Vinyl stays famous on the grounds that it is most economical and simply readily available in styles that in shape the average Courtice streetscape. Installed wisely, it handles thermal movement good and shrugs off most climate. The caveat is growth and contraction. Crews desire to leave the excellent hole at the nailing slots and use the good hook on J-channels. On south and west elevations, where sunlight hits demanding, I specify lighter hues to avert warm construct and competencies oil-canning.
Fiber cement fits home owners who need a painted timber glance with no the rot danger. It stands up well across the open areas near South Courtice Arena wherein wind publicity is excessive. It is heavier than vinyl, so fastening patterns count, and chopping ought to be airborne dirt and dust-managed. You will prefer stainless or scorching-dip galvanized nails, rainscreen furring in lots of cases, and cautious flashing at horizontal joints.
Engineered wood has elevated. Modern items resist swelling more beneficial than the older versions that harmed the class’s recognition. If you like trim-prosperous façades or craftsman info discovered on some Cul-de-sacs off Bloor Street, engineered picket provides warmth that vinyl struggles to tournament. Keep a refreshing drip edge above grade and most desirable all reduce ends religiously.
Metal siding has grown in popularity for accessory walls or modern builds. When we used metallic panels on a belongings near the Darlington Nuclear Generating Station corridor, the owner cherished the crisp traces and low repairs. It requires distinctive design and enlargement planning, and also you want a crew comfy with trim kits and panel sequencing.
The top alternative characteristically blends components. I am a fan of combining a long lasting lap for the principle discipline with vertical panels on gables and a stone or brick veneer on the bottom. Done exact, this creates depth with out making repairs a headache.
Windows that reduce drafts and noise without having a look bulky
Courtice winters call for actual glazing. Triple-pane makes a difference in bedrooms on north faces and in predominant rooms exposed to the winning wind. I specify double or triple low-E coatings relying at the orientation. On the south facet, you favor to restriction photo voltaic obtain if you have monstrous unshaded glass; on the north, you desire the first-rate U-component which you can come up with the money for.
Frames count as a lot as glass. Vinyl frames provide sensible importance, composite frames withstand move and swelling, and wood-clad frames go well with history-leaning exteriors. For a two-tale on Prestonvale Road, a composite body solved the enlargement mismatch we were seeing among a dark-painted sash and the encompassing trim, which had led to seasonal binding.
Installation is the lever that prevents callbacks. Here is the sequence I follow on most retrofit projects: careful removing to protect inner finishes, assess sill slope and restoration if wished, self-adhered flashing at the sill with a to come back dam, side tapes lapped correct, shims positioned at hinge features on operable sets, then foam air seal it's low-expansion round the perimeter. On windy websites close to Highway 401, a neglected nook on a sill tape can translate into a whistling draft that drives a property owner mad with the aid of February.
Grilles and sightlines additionally count number for cut down enchantment. On streets round Varcoe Road, many residences lift colonial grids. If you're blending historical and new home windows, event the lite styles and the muntin thickness so replacements do not telegraph as “aftermarket.” Small aspect, immense visual payoff.
Entry doorways that welcome and protect
The front door carries various weight. It is a handshake to the road and the primary line opposed to air and water. Steel doorways present protection and value, and with impressive paint they appearance sharp. Fiberglass doors have enhanced to the element where a textured fiberglass with a wonderful stain fools maximum other folks at a look, and it'll now not dent like steel or swell like wooden.
Two keys circumvent average complications. First, the brink and subsill will have to be dead degree, fully supported, and set with a non-stop bead of brilliant sealant. Any void the following will become a water catch. Second, the frame would have to be sq. underneath running loads. I have had doorways in Courtice that seemed rectangular on a degree, however the home had settled a bit and the latch would now not align in January. By shimming on the hinge part and fairly relieving the strike, we solved what seemed like a “negative door” devoid of exchanging it.
If your access will get hammered by using wind off the lake, think about a hurricane door with a draining sill or a deeper overhang. Double doors appear grand, however a unmarried door with sidelites occasionally seals more beneficial in real lifestyles. For aspect https://emilianoqysx347.iamarrows.com/renovation-expert-courtice-on-smart-upgrades-for-2025 entries near the garage, use a comfortable fiberglass or steel slab for you to no longer capture dirt in deep grain while salt and slush get kicked in opposition to it.
Coordinating siding, windows, and doors in order that they paintings together
When you touch one piece of the envelope, you have got how it intersects with the relaxation. Replace home windows beforehand new siding, or at the least element the window flashing in a approach that anticipates the siding’s profile and J-channels. On a makeover simply east of Courtice Community Complex, we scheduled the window crew a week in advance of the siders, then the door deploy remaining. This sequencing allow us to lap all flashings effectively and continue the WRB continuous.
Trim kits and colourways help tie every thing in combination. I like a 3-colour palette: foremost container shade for siding, a contrasting yet muted tone for trim, and a deeper accessory at the door. In shaded masses close Pebblestone Road, pass a notch lighter so the area does not recede too much against mature bushes. Matte finishes cover grime larger than excessive-gloss.

Durability in a freeze-thaw climate
Courtice sits in a area in which cycles of freeze and thaw are not unusual, which makes water leadership integral. Drip caps above window and door heads are usually not decorative; they may be a trouble-free piece of assurance. Kick-out flashing in which a roof intersects a wall stops water from strolling at the back of your siding and appearing up as a mysterious indoors stain. If your eavestroughs sell off too as regards to corners, those corners will age faster. On a dwelling near West Beach in Bowmanville, the fix used to be as essential as including longer downspout extensions and a stone splash pad.
Fasteners are one more quiet element. Use corrosion-resistant nails or screws detailed by way of the siding enterprise. I actually have noticed reasonable fasteners depart rust streaks after two winters. Keep clearance from grade, repeatedly 6 to eight inches, and greater if the snowbanks build up on your lot.

Hidden pitfalls I watch for
Older aluminum-clad homes can cover rotten sheathing at deck ledgers or under leaking pale furnishings. Before re-siding, pull furnishings and check penetration factors. On window retrofits, look forward to out-of-square openings that a foam gun is not going to restore. In iciness, dodge taking out too many windows right away; change in stages to avert heat loss viable. On door installs, be sure floor heights peculiarly once you plan long run flooring install Courtice that may increase thresholds and intervene with swing or clearance.
Maintenance that protects your investment
Once the work is completed, preservation is pale yet major. Rinse siding in spring to cast off salt and grime. Keep shrubs trimmed lower back to permit the walls breathe and to restrict abrasion. Check caulk lines annually, above all at the south and west exposures. Lubricate door hinges and regulate strikes until now wintry weather. Wash window weep holes so that they do now not clog with pollen or particles. These small obligations sustain that freshly finished glance and sidestep small trouble turning out to be steeply-priced.
